Equipping learners with practical troubleshooting abilities and safe authentication habits permanently removes the intimidation factor that often accompanies unfamiliar, fast-changing personal computing tools.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Why Digital Literacy Is Different From Device Distribution<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Distributing hardware without comprehensive educational instruction fails to resolve systemic digital exclusion, because access to physical machines does not inherently confer functional skill, digital resilience, or online safety awareness. A laptop or tablet remains entirely ineffective if the recipient cannot evaluate information reliability, navigate complex software interfaces, or protect personal information from phishing exploits. Meaningful digital inclusion demands comprehensive human support, ongoing localized mentoring, and practical training that contextualizes how hardware can solve actual daily challenges. True inclusion happens only when community members gain the confidence and knowledge needed to leverage these digital devices for lifelong education, healthcare management, and sustainable economic advancement.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Why Responsible AI Research Matters<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Rigorous <strong>Responsible AI Research<\/strong> establishes vital technical and ethical frameworks to ensure automated algorithmic systems operate transparently, equitably, and with consistent human oversight. Because machine learning models often inherit, reinforce, or amplify historical societal prejudices from unvetted training data, dedicated researchers must systematically investigate algorithmic bias, explainability, and secure data privacy protocols. Prioritizing human dignity and community participation throughout model development prevents automated tools from unfairly penalizing marginalized populations during critical determinations in employment, housing, or criminal justice. Embedding accountability into every stage of development guarantees that artificial intelligence functions as a reliable, transparent public utility rather than an unchecked, discriminatory black box.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">What Is AI for Social Impact?<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Deploying <strong>AI for Social Impact<\/strong> means applying advanced predictive modeling, natural language processing, and automated analytics directly to longstanding civic, environmental, and humanitarian challenges. By nurturing homegrown talent early, community organizations create sustainable talent pipelines that empower rising generations to lead local economic and social renewal.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Scenario: A Student Solving a Local Problem<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Consider a high school student in a peri-urban community who notices that local elderly residents routinely miss essential bus services due to erratic paper timetables and inconsistent transit updates. Guided by experienced volunteer mentors within a local youth innovation incubator, the student conducts neighborhood interviews, maps transit routes, and builds a lightweight, open-source mobile notification tool accessible via basic SMS. Rather than relying on costly enterprise infrastructure, the project leverages open data standards and low-bandwidth web hooks, enabling residents to receive reliable arrival alerts directly on inexpensive feature phones. Through iterative field testing and direct community feedback, the student acquires practical software engineering competencies while solving a persistent municipal transit problem.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Technology Education Programs and Workforce Development<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Comprehensive <strong>Technology Education Programs<\/strong> serve as vital engines for sustainable economic mobility by delivering targeted upskilling, practical certifications, and modern career-readiness training to learners at every stage of life. Because learning requirements differ significantly across diverse demographic groups, training providers must tailor instructional methodologies to accommodate distinct professional, academic, and socio-economic realities: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Students:<\/strong> Require foundational computing literacy, collaborative project-based learning, and exploratory introductions to programming, scientific logic, and ethical problem-solving to build long-term career curiosity.<\/li>\n\n\n\n<li><strong>Working Professionals:<\/strong> Benefit most from flexible, asynchronous upskilling modules focused on specialized certifications, automation workflows, modern data tools, and practical management applications to maintain industry relevance.<\/li>\n\n\n\n<li><strong>Educators:<\/strong> Need structured professional development, adaptable classroom curricula, and pedagogical coaching to integrate modern digital productivity suites and collaborative platforms seamlessly into everyday instructional environments.<\/li>\n\n\n\n<li><strong>Underserved Communities:<\/strong> Rely on deeply localized, low-barrier vocational programs that provide access to physical hardware, internet connectivity, direct career mentorship, and practical workplace digital competencies.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">How Nonprofit Digital Transformation Works<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">True <strong>Nonprofit Digital Transformation<\/strong> involves intentionally restructuring an organization&#8217;s operational workflows, communication channels, and service delivery mechanisms through modern, cloud-based digital infrastructure. Rather than accumulating disconnected commercial software applications, mission-driven organizations must carefully identify operational bottlenecks, automate repetitive administrative tasks, and implement secure data-collection systems to elevate their overall social impact. Successfully modernizing legacy organizational workflows requires viewing technology as an operational enabler that supports human staff, protects donor and constituent privacy, and frees valuable institutional resources to focus directly on frontline community assistance.<\/p>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><thead><tr><td><strong>Stage<\/strong><\/td><td><strong>Key Question<\/strong><\/td><td><strong>Example Action<\/strong><\/td><\/tr><\/thead><tbody><tr><td><strong>Assess<\/strong><\/td><td>Where do current operational bottlenecks hinder social mission delivery?<\/td><td>Audit manual spreadsheet workflows and administrative backlogs<\/td><\/tr><tr><td><strong>Prioritize<\/strong><\/td><td>Which digital upgrade delivers immediate value to our constituents?<\/td><td>Focus initial investments on client onboarding and secure intake systems<\/td><\/tr><tr><td><strong>Design<\/strong><\/td><td>How should new tools integrate without disrupting daily community outreach?<\/td><td>Create clear process maps that reflect actual frontline staff routines<\/td><\/tr><tr><td><strong>Select<\/strong><\/td><td>Which cost-effective platform satisfies our privacy and security mandates?<\/td><td>Evaluate secure open-source or discounted nonprofit cloud services<\/td><\/tr><tr><td><strong>Implement<\/strong><\/td><td>How do we train staff effectively without creating operational fatigue?<\/td><td>Roll out phased software training with designated internal peer champions<\/td><\/tr><tr><td><strong>Measure<\/strong><\/td><td>Did the implementation improve service delivery speed and constituent safety?<\/td><td>Track time saved on data entry and survey community satisfaction<\/td><\/tr><tr><td><strong>Improve<\/strong><\/td><td>What ongoing adjustments are necessary based on staff feedback?<\/td><td>Refine data fields, automate recurring reports, and review security access<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\">Corporate Social Impact Partnerships<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Structured <strong>Corporate Social Impact Partnerships<\/strong> unite private-sector enterprise resources with mission-driven community organizations to address entrenched digital disparities through strategic, measurable collaboration. Furthermore, committing to open-source publication and shared data practices enables social-impact organizations worldwide to replicate successful community initiatives, avoid redundant technical errors, and collectively elevate the overall effectiveness of the broader public-interest technology movement.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Real-Life Scenario \u2013 Rural Digital Inclusion Project<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Consider a hypothetical initiative addressing a remote agricultural valley where erratic broadband connectivity and limited computing access prevent farming families from accessing municipal public services, markets, and online educational tools. The project initiates by organizing community town halls to identify precise local priorities, followed by thorough infrastructure mapping that documents actual device availability, satellite coverage constraints, and community power reliability. Rather than distributing unmanaged personal computers, organizers establish a community solar-powered learning hub equipped with refurbished hardware, ruggedized local cache servers, and reliable wireless access. Local coordinators then lead bilingual digital literacy workshops teaching internet navigation, online banking security, and digital crop pricing verification, ultimately creating a self-sustaining local committee to manage the hub permanently.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Real-Life Scenario \u2013 Responsible AI in Education<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">In another hypothetical scenario, a regional school district explores using an automated early-warning system to identify secondary students who may need additional academic tutoring or social support services. Recognizing substantial data privacy and demographic bias risks, district leaders partner with independent technical researchers to audit the underlying predictive algorithm before deployment, ensuring historical disciplinary imbalances do not unfairly skew risk scores. System designers intentionally implement human-in-the-loop protocols, mandating that algorithmic alerts serve purely as gentle advisory signals for certified guidance counselors rather than triggering automated academic tracking or disciplinary actions. Transparent workshops with parents, educators, and students explain exactly what data inputs the system evaluates, ensuring continuous community oversight and regular model recalibration to protect student dignity.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Common Mistakes to Avoid<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Equating Hardware Distribution With Genuine Inclusion:<\/strong> Purchasing laptops or mobile devices without providing ongoing digital skills instruction, technical troubleshooting, and online safety education leaves recipients unable to use tools effectively.<\/li>\n\n\n\n<li><strong>Deploying Algorithmic Tools Without Bias Auditing:<\/strong> Implementing artificial intelligence systems in social programs without thoroughly auditing training data inevitably amplifies systemic historical discrimination against marginalized groups.<\/li>\n\n\n\n<li><strong>Selecting Software Before Identifying Core Problems:<\/strong> Purchasing commercial software licenses before thoroughly mapping existing organizational workflows results in expensive shelfware that staff routinely abandon.<\/li>\n\n\n\n<li><strong>Neglecting Ongoing Maintenance and Security:<\/strong> Building digital platforms without budgeting for continuous security updates, server patches, and technical maintenance leads to rapid system failure and severe data breaches.<\/li>\n\n\n\n<li><strong>Ignoring Local Community Voices in Project Design:<\/strong> Imposing top-down technological solutions without consulting local community members produces systems that fail to address authentic grassroots priorities.<\/li>\n\n\n\n<li><strong>Relying Exclusively on Proprietary Data Silos:<\/strong> Storing community data within closed vendor architectures prevents cross-sector collaboration, inflates long-term operational costs, and risks vendor lock-in.<\/li>\n\n\n\n<li><strong>Treating Digital Literacy as a One-Time Event:<\/strong> Conducting isolated training workshops without providing continuous practice, advanced learning pathways, and ongoing mentorship fails to build lasting technical resilience.<\/li>\n\n\n\n<li><strong>Overlooking Accessibility Standards in Design:<\/strong> Launching public websites and digital applications without adhering to strict web accessibility guidelines directly excludes users with visual, auditory, or motor impairments.<\/li>\n\n\n\n<li><strong>Underestimating Staff Training Requirements:<\/strong> Rolling out new organizational cloud tools without allocating sufficient time and resources for comprehensive employee onboarding generates severe operational resistance.<\/li>\n\n\n\n<li><strong>Failing to Establish Clear Impact Metrics:<\/strong> Launching technology-for-good programs without defining objective, measurable social outcomes leaves organizations unable to evaluate real-world efficacy.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">How to Evaluate a Technology Nonprofit<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Before committing valuable time, philanthropic funding, or collaborative organizational resources to a technology-focused mission, stakeholders must thoroughly evaluate the entity&#8217;s operational transparency, community relationships, and technical competence.
